‘Royal Regalia: Signatures, Statecraft and Sovereignty’ Exhibition
On 5th June 2026, ‘Royal Regalia: Signatures, Statecraft and Sovereignty’ Exhibition was held at New College, Oxford. The exhibition included ‘New College MS 328’, which the exhibition described as ‘Royal wardrobe warrants of the Tudor monarchs, and a rare signature … Continue reading

Lady Katherine Grey – ‘Now You See Us’ Exhibition at Tate Britain
The V&A’s miniature of Lady Katherine Grey is part of the ‘Now You See Us’ exhibition’ at the Tate Britain. The exhibition runs until 13th October. ‘Spanning 400 years, this exhibition follows women on their journeys to becoming professional artists. … Continue reading
